The local government pension scheme (LGPS) super pools have ‘a lot of ground’ to cover if the promised savings from the shake-up are to be achieved, an expert has warned.
Writing for The MJ’s website, international head of pensions and infrastructure segments at investment firm BNY Mellon, Paul Traynor, urged local authorities not to underestimate the change in mindset needed over the next year.
